Water and irrigation in plant cultivation

Water is an essential element for all crops. It transports nutrients and allows plants to grow and reproduce. Therefore, in plant cultivation, it is very important to have sufficient water available for the crop. But how much water do plants actually need and how can you ensure that plants get enough water?

How much water do your plants need?

The amount of water plants need depends on several factors. For example, the type of plant plays a role, but also the size of the plant, the size of the pot and the environment in which the plant grows.

How can you make sure plants get enough water?

To ensure that plants get enough water, irrigation is often used in plant cultivation. This involves giving water to plants in a controlled way. This can be done in different ways, such as through drip irrigation, sprinkling or using an irrigation system.

Drip irrigation is a way of irrigation where water is given to the plants through small holes in the hose or tube, drop by drop. This method of irrigation is very efficient and ensures that the water reaches the roots of the plant directly. As a result, no water is lost and the plants receive just enough water.

Sprinkler irrigation is a method of irrigation that uses a sprinkler to deliver water to the plants. This is a less efficient method of irrigation because a lot of water is lost through the sprinkler. In addition, irrigation can cause damage to the plants because the water can damage the leaves.

An irrigation system is a method of irrigation in which water is given to the plants through pipes and hoses. This system can be very efficient because the water gets directly to the roots of the plant. In addition, the irrigation system can be programmed so that the water is given at set times and the plants always get enough water.

Conclusion

Water is an essential element for plants, so in plant cultivation it is very important to ensure that sufficient water is available for the plants. By using irrigation, it can be ensured that the plants get enough water.
